1. Product Overview

Hospital Storage Cabinets are designed to store a wide range of healthcare items, including medicines, surgical instruments, personal protective equipment (PPE), diagnostic devices, and administrative records. Constructed from high-quality materials such as stainless steel, powder-coated metal, or high-density laminates, these cabinets are built to withstand daily usage, maintain hygiene standards, and ensure long-term durability.

Modern cabinets often feature lockable compartments, adjustable shelving, modular storage options, antimicrobial surfaces, and integrated security systems. These features allow hospitals to customize the cabinets to meet specific needs while complying with healthcare regulations. Ergonomic handles and smooth drawer slides ensure ease of access, while labels and transparent panels enhance visibility and organization.


2. Core Features and Advantages

a. Secure Storage
Lockable doors and compartments provide safe storage for medications, controlled substances, and sensitive equipment, preventing unauthorized access and ensuring compliance with regulatory standards.

b. Organization and Accessibility
Adjustable shelves, drawers, and modular compartments make it easy to organize medical items logically. Clear labeling systems and optional transparent doors enhance visibility, allowing staff to quickly locate items and reduce retrieval time.

c. Durability and Hygiene
High-quality materials such as stainless steel, powder-coated metals, or antimicrobial laminates ensure long-term durability and easy cleaning. Smooth surfaces and antimicrobial coatings reduce the risk of infection and cross-contamination, essential in hospitals and clinical environments.

d. Space Optimization
Available in various sizes and configurations, hospital storage cabinets maximize vertical and horizontal storage space. Customizable layouts allow hospitals to optimize inventory management and ensure high-volume items are readily accessible.

e. Ergonomic Design
Cabinets are designed with user-friendly handles, soft-close doors, and smooth drawer slides to minimize staff fatigue and ensure safe handling of medical supplies, even during busy shifts.

f. Customizable Options
Hospitals can select cabinets with specialized compartments for surgical instruments, pharmaceuticals, diagnostic tools, or PPE. Some cabinets feature integrated locks, digital monitoring, or electronic access controls to enhance operational efficiency and security.


3. Applications in Healthcare

  • Hospitals: Ward supply storage, ICU instrument organization, pharmacy stock management, and operating room equipment storage.

  • Clinics and Outpatient Centers: Organized storage for medications, diagnostic tools, and clinical instruments.

  • Laboratories: Safe storage of chemicals, reagents, and precision instruments.

  • Long-Term Care Facilities: Storing medications, personal care items, and daily care supplies.

  • Emergency and Mobile Units: Rapid access to medical supplies in critical situations.


4. Solving Key Pain Points

Healthcare providers often face challenges including:

  • Difficulty finding essential supplies, leading to delayed care.

  • Risk of contamination or damage to sensitive equipment.

  • Security concerns regarding controlled substances or confidential patient data.

  • Inefficient use of limited storage space in busy hospital environments.

Hospital Storage Cabinets address these issues by centralizing medical supplies in an organized, secure, and hygienic manner. They reduce retrieval time, prevent unauthorized access, optimize storage space, and maintain compliance with hygiene standards, improving overall workflow efficiency and patient safety.
